Output ba041567d1c8a83e770c177d14fe434cf80292944c5129e99b0a637e641a0009:6

value
3852228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7141c5eed9f18b8cb6e05436a75f8baf575923b OP_EQUAL
address
3QDSvFUXrFTh2tLnUF6eNudbr7RH6cmTRV
transaction
ba041567d1c8a83e770c177d14fe434cf80292944c5129e99b0a637e641a0009
confirmations
195134
spent
true